Section 21.105 - Fees for Disposal of Real Estate Interests

Universal Citation: 43 TX Admin Code § 21.105

Current through Reg. 50, No. 13; March 28, 2025

(a) The department will charge a service fee to cover basic costs in the disposal of real property under this subchapter.

(1) For quitclaims where the state holds no record title, holds easement title only, or holds title subject to a reversionary clause, a service fee of $300 will be charged to cover the costs of handling each quitclaim.

(2) For sales, a service fee will be charged in the amount of $300 or 2.0% of the sale price, whichever is more. The service fee shall not exceed $1,600.

(b) Service fees shall not apply if:

(1) the conveyance is being made to correct a previous error;

(2) a property or property interest is being exchanged for other property interests needed for highway purposes;

(3) a property or property interest is being sold, quitclaimed, or transferred to a county, city, state, or federal governmental agency; or

(4) the commission determines the service fee to be unjust or unwarranted.
